Aerobic and resistance exercise-regulated phosphoproteome and acetylproteome modifications in human skeletal muscle

Abstract Despite indisputable benefits of different exercise modes, the molecular underpinnings of their divergent responses remain unclear. We investigate post-translational modifications in human skeletal muscle following 12 weeks of high-intensity aerobic interval or resistance exercise training....
